S. 2842 (97th)

A bill to provide for equitable waiver in the compromise and collection of federal claims.

Summary

Authorizes the Comptroller General and the head of any Federal agency to grant equitable waivers of claims of the United States against persons for erroneous payments of travel, transportation, or relocation expenses if: (1) such payments occurred on or after January 1, 1979; and (2) an application for waiver is received within three years after such an erroneous payment was made. Increases from $500 to $5,000 the maximum amount of a claim for the erroneous payment of pay, allowances, or such expenses which may be waived by an agency head.
